Transaction 657fab38cd3f804a4dd2f1ef0dee379492350ae14bf13247c4847fd870010d6f

10 Input
2 Outputs
  • 657fab38cd3f804a4dd2f1ef0dee379492350ae14bf13247c4847fd870010d6f:0
  • value  6131505
    address  3JQYrSgKD5Zd5K9KJ8Hf3azhjYnkxzc9XY
  • 657fab38cd3f804a4dd2f1ef0dee379492350ae14bf13247c4847fd870010d6f:1
  • value  195738
    address  3HFTczX2CtPUzKSG45v2G4xn57eD5E71MJ